We had several people send us pieces of art that they purchased with “McClung” as a signature, wondering if was Miriam’s artwork. After some research, we discovered an amazing 20th-century woman artist, Florence Elliott McClung, from Texas.

There have been several painters with the last name “McClung” over the past century to include Catherine McClung, a daughter of a cousin of Miriam’s.

Most of Miriam’s work is geographically centered around the eastern part of the United States: Alabama, Tennessee, North Carolina, and Birmingham in particular. She doesn’t have any work featuring the Western United States that we are aware of.
